    Markit, a leading, global financial information services company, today announced that it has created a new set of tools to help traders and risk managers identify the correlations between changes in the value of credit default swaps (CDS) and movements in stock and options markets.  The new data service, Markit Credit Factors, will provide customers with the first sentiment signals for CDS produced by an independent financial information firm.

    Today, Bank Negara Malaysia hosted the second meeting of the Financial Stability Board (FSB) Regional Consultative Group for Asia in Kuala Lumpur, Malaysia. The group was established pursuant to  the  FSB’s  announcement in  November 2010  that  it  intends to expand and formalise outreach beyond its membership. To this end, six regional consultative groups1  were established to bring together financial authorities from FSB member and non- member economies to exchange views on vulnerabilities affecting financial systems and on initiatives to promote financial stability.

    The Stock Exchange of Thailand (SET) joins forces with other capital market organizations in restoring 59 schools hit by the 2011 massive flood crisis through a project called “Restoring flooded schools, Building relationships with communities,” aiming to build sustainability to schools and communities.
